1. What Are Essential Oils for Aromatherapy Candles?
Essential oils for aromatherapy candles are plant-based oils extracted from flowers, herbs, and other natural sources. These oils are known for their therapeutic properties, which can have a positive impact on both physical and emotional well-being. When added to candles, these oils are released as the candle burns, infusing the air with a calming, invigorating, or mood-enhancing scent. Aromatherapy candles use these oils to promote relaxation, alleviate stress, improve sleep, and enhance overall wellness in your home.
2. Benefits of Relaxing Aromatherapy Candles
Relaxing aromatherapy candles offer numerous benefits that help to create a peaceful and stress-free environment in your home. Here are some of the key advantages:
Stress Relief
The soothing scents of aromatherapy candles can help reduce anxiety and stress. Essential oils such as lavender, chamomile, and bergamot are known for their calming properties, making them perfect for unwinding after a long day or during stressful situations.
Improved Sleep Quality
Aromatherapy candles with relaxing scents like lavender, sandalwood, and jasmine can promote better sleep by calming the nervous system. The gentle aromas create a peaceful atmosphere that can help you fall asleep faster and enjoy a deeper, more restful sleep.
Enhanced Mood and Mental Clarity
Many relaxing essential oils also help to elevate your mood and improve mental clarity. Scents such as citrus, peppermint, and eucalyptus are energizing and uplifting, helping to clear mental fog and improve focus during your daily tasks.
id="best-essential-oils-for-relaxation">3. Best Essential Oils for Relaxing Aromatherapy Candles
If you're looking to create the perfect relaxing atmosphere, the following essential oils are ideal for aromatherapy candles:
Lavender Essential Oil
Lavender is one of the most popular essential oils for relaxation. Its calming properties help reduce stress, promote restful sleep, and soothe tension. Lavender-scented candles are perfect for creating a tranquil atmosphere in your home.
Chamomile Essential Oil
Chamomile is another soothing oil often used in aromatherapy. It is known for its ability to ease anxiety, improve sleep, and promote relaxation. Chamomile-scented candles are ideal for winding down in the evening.
Sandalwood Essential Oil
Sandalwood has a deep, grounding aroma that promotes mental clarity and relaxation. It’s often used in meditation practices and is perfect for enhancing focus while providing a calming effect. Sandalwood-scented candles can add a calming and peaceful atmosphere to any space.
Ylang-Ylang Essential Oil
Ylang-ylang has a sweet, floral scent that is known for its mood-boosting properties. It can help reduce stress and create a sense of calm, making it a great addition to your aromatherapy candle collection.
4. How to Make Relaxing Aromatherapy Candles
Making your own relaxing aromatherapy candles is a simple and enjoyable DIY project. Here's a basic guide to creating your own soothing candles:
Materials You Will Need
- Candle wax (soy wax is a great choice for a clean, slow burn)
- Your choice of relaxing essential oils (lavender, chamomile, sandalwood, etc.)
- A wick (preferably a cotton wick)
- A heatproof container (like a mason jar or glass container)
- A thermometer to monitor the wax temperature
Steps to Make the Candles
- Melt the wax in a double boiler, stirring occasionally.
- Once the wax is melted, remove it from heat and let it cool slightly. Add your essential oils. The typical ratio is 1 ounce of essential oil per pound of wax.
- Secure the wick at the bottom of your container and pour the melted wax into the container, leaving some space at the top.
- Let the candle cool and harden. Trim the wick before lighting your candle.
5. How to Use Aromatherapy Candles for Relaxation
To maximize the relaxing benefits of your aromatherapy candles, consider the following tips:
Place Candles in Key Areas
Place your candles in areas where you spend time unwinding, such as your bedroom, living room, or bathroom. Lighting the candle in these spaces can enhance relaxation and create a calming environment.
Pair with Other Relaxation Techniques
For the ultimate relaxation experience, combine your aromatherapy candles with practices like meditation, deep breathing, or a warm bath. The scents from the candles will help deepen the sense of calm.
Create a Daily Routine
Make lighting your aromatherapy candles part of your self-care routine. Whether it’s during your morning routine to energize or at night to wind down, candles can create a peaceful ritual that enhances your well-being.
